Lithuania holds parliamentary runoff

VILNIUS, Oct. 22 (Xinhua) -- Lithuania on Tuesday started early voting for a runoff in 63 single-seat constituencies, as part of the country's parliamentary elections.

The Central Electoral Commission said that polling stations would be open each day from 7:00 a.m. (0400 GMT) Tuesday until Thursday for early voters in all 60 municipalities. Early voting at other facilities or at home would start successively from Wednesday to Saturday.

The runoff is between the two leading MP candidates in each of the 63 single-seat constituencies.

Lithuania held the first round of voting on Oct. 13 for its 141-seat unicameral parliament, producing 70 MPs in the multi-member constituency and eight in single-member districts, for a four-year term.

The remaining 63 single-seat constituencies have entered the second round. The runoff's Election Day is set for Sunday. Enditem
